Health Considerations for Residents Near TRANSCONTINENTAL SPARTANBURG

Living near a Toxic Release Inventory (TRI) facility in SPARTANBURG, South Carolina (29302) means potential exposure to industrial pollutants through air, water, and soil. While not every facility creates immediate health risks, long-term proximity warrants awareness and proactive steps.

Water Testing

Given the water quality score of 10/100 for zip code 29302, we recommend annual water testing for heavy metals, VOCs, and industrial contaminants — especially if you use well water. Testing kits are available through your county health department or certified labs.

Air Quality Monitoring

Air quality in this area scores 25/100 — below average. Monitor daily AQI (Air Quality Index) at airnow.gov, particularly on hot, stagnant days when ground-level pollutants concentrate. If you notice unusual odors or visible emissions from TRANSCONTINENTAL SPARTANBURG, report them to South Carolina's environmental agency.

When to Consult a Doctor

Speak with your physician if you experience persistent respiratory symptoms (chronic cough, wheezing, shortness of breath), unexplained headaches, skin irritation, or unusual fatigue — particularly if these worsen when you're at home. Mention your proximity to a TRI facility so they can order appropriate screening. Vulnerable populations — children, elderly, pregnant women, and those with asthma — should be especially vigilant.
